Meeting in Golden
In October 2013, the Columbia River Treaty Review Team hosted a meeting in Golden of industry, community organization representatives, local government and private individuals with an interest in issues related to recreation and road access near Kinbasket Reservoir. Representatives from Columbia Basin Trust and other provincial agencies also attended this meeting. The all-day meeting gathered together many of the key stakeholders in the region and included an onsite visit to Bush Harbour on Kinbasket Reservoir to discuss some of the issues related to the reservoir, including road conditions and recreation opportunities.
One of the action items arising from the meeting will be a review of the existing geotechnical information and further analysis of the geohazard risk and risk tolerance as well as an identification of further work that may be required. The Province and Columbia Basin Trust will be co-funding this study. It is anticipated this study will be complete by March 2014.
